Key Differences
In short — Core i5-12600KF outperforms the cheaper Celeron G1610 on the selected game parameters. However, the worse performing Celeron G1610 is a better bang for your buck. The better performing Core i5-12600KF is 3258 days newer than the cheaper Celeron G1610.
Advantages of Intel Core i5-12600KF
- Performs up to 12% better in Dead Space than Celeron G1610 - 161 vs 144 FPS
- Can execute more multi-threaded tasks simultaneously than Intel Celeron G1610 - 16 vs 2 threads
Advantages of Intel Celeron G1610
- Up to 77% cheaper than Core i5-12600KF - $27.05 vs $116.36
- Up to 74% better value when playing Dead Space than Core i5-12600KF - $0.21 vs $0.8 per FPS
- Consumes up to 56% less energy than Intel Core i5-12600KF - 55 vs 125 Watts
- Works without a dedicated GPU, while Intel Core i5-12600KF doesn't have integrated graphics

Intel Core i5-12600KF | vs | Intel Celeron G1610 |
---|---|---|
Nov 4th, 2021 | Release Date | Dec 3rd, 2012 |
Core i5 | Collection | Celeron |
Alder Lake | Codename | Ivy Bridge |
Intel Socket 1700 | Socket | Intel Socket 1155 |
Desktop | Segment | Desktop |
10 | Cores | 2 |
16 | Threads | 2 |
3.7 GHz | Base Clock Speed | 2.6 GHz |
4.9 GHz | Turbo Clock Speed | Non-Turbo |
125 W | TDP | 55 W |
10 nm | Process Size | 22 nm |
37.0x | Multiplier | 26.0x |
None | Integrated Graphics | Intel HD |
Yes | Overclockable | No |
